Welcome to 56 Hawthorne Crescent - a beautifully maintained 3-bedroom freehold townhome backing onto mature forest in a quiet, family-friendly neighbourhood of South Barrie. Featuring newly installed vinyl flooring (2025) and modern finishes throughout, this home offers a warm and inviting open-concept main floor filled with natural light. The kitchen provides great functionality for everyday living and entertaining, while the upper level features three comfortable bedrooms, including a spacious primary with generous closet space. The private backyard with no rear neighbours is ideal for relaxing, morning coffee, or hosting summer BBQs. Conveniently located close to schools, parks, shopping, walking trails, transit, Highway 400, and Barrie's stunning waterfront and vibrant downtown. Recent upgrades include: new furnace (2019), water softener (2019), hot water tank (2022), roof shingles (2016)

Ardagh, Barrie is a north GTA ne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ives, business and education, law & public sector professionals and salesp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 40 to 59.
